Output 01d2ea8e6c508b2505709c6cb480d819c75134ac38d6ee4a1c7267b6b14b6bf5:0

value
333823629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86813bc05718f24d352cc31b9e3ead40b7007f8f OP_EQUAL
address
3DxDHYU2D23EtQWYNCeHGvcwgHDMtGK3Zt
transaction
01d2ea8e6c508b2505709c6cb480d819c75134ac38d6ee4a1c7267b6b14b6bf5
spent
true